Latrobe Valley Umpires Association provides community AFL umpires to competitions in and around the Latrobe Valley and South Gippsland.
The Latrobe Valley Umpires Association
The LVUA has a Senior Panel which umpires the Gippsland League, Mid Gippsland Football Netball League and Female Football Gippsland, and a Development Panel which umpires the Traralgon & District Junior Football League.
Our umpires love what they do and are a close and highly supportive team. Every member is encouraged to achieve at their own level and there are opportunities for all ages and levels of fitness in the disciplines of field, boundary and goal. Umpires are reimbursed for their game time, travel costs and first uniform, and registration costs are lower than most community sports.
Umpiring with Latrobe Valley Umpires Association
No experience necessary: Coaching and support are provided as you build confidence.
Train locally: Wednesdays at 6.00 pm, February to September, at Maryvale Reserve in Morwell.
Choose your role: Learn field, boundary or goal umpiring—or develop skills in more than one discipline.
Umpire local competitions: Opportunities are available across the Gippsland League, Mid Gippsland Football Netball League, Female Football Gippsland and Traralgon and District Junior Football League.
Get paid: Umpires receive match payments and travel reimbursement, with substantial subsidisation of uniform costs and very minimal registration costs.
Choose your commitment: Umpire one game or several, depending on your availability and goals.

INCLUSIVE FAMILY ENVIRONMENT
Latrobe Valley Umpires Association welcomes members of all ages, abilities and backgrounds. One of the highlights of our sport is the ability for young and old to work together on the field, leading to a number of family groups umpiring together with us.
We also pride ourselves on a child safe environment, and promote participation for females in the sport as well, through encouraging female umpires and ensuring provision to Womens and Girls’ Football.
